Background
Dr Zyta Ziora received PhD (Wroclaw University of Science & Technology, Poland) in chemistry and has wide range of experience in development of antimalarial therapeutics (the University of Montpellier, France), antibacterial agents, enzyme inhibitors and drug candidates against Alzheimer disease (Kyoto Pharmaceutical University, Japan). Her research time is currently dedicated mainly to projects devoted to the modification of existing antibiotics, and complexing them with additional antimicrobial agents, like metal ions, to produce more potent alternatives and by this to overcome the drug resistance of superbugs. She is also working on alternative to antibiotics nature-derived compounds with antimicrobial and anticancer potency, such poliphenolic derivatives to control tyrosinase function.

Available projects
-
engineered mesoporous silica nanoparticles loaded with natural bioactive molecules for breast cancer therapy
Silica nanoparticles afford excellent carriers for drug loading and ligand conjugation. This project will design nanoformulations loaded with bioactive molecules. Engineered particles conjugated with ligands/antibodies will achieve high efficacy of nature derived molecules for breast cancer therapy.
